光伏在能量收集上的应用与解决方案 光伏在能量收集上的应用与解决方案 发布日期:2025-10-03

光伏系统是一种将太阳光能直接转换为电能的可再生能源技术。其主要的系统架构大致可分为光伏电池模块、逆变器、电源管理系统、储能系统等。在光伏能量收集应用上,重点则将放在小型、低功耗设备从太阳光中自主取得电力,以实现无需更换电池或延长使用寿命的目标。这在物联网、可穿戴设备与远程监控等领域特别重要。

能量收集技术与未来应用发展趋势 能量收集技术与未来应用发展趋势 发布日期:2025-09-29

当前的能量收集技术已经成为关键的创新领域之一,这项技术通过回收环境中原本尚未被利用的能量,例如太阳能、热能、振动能、无线电波能量等,将之转换为可用的电力,为各类设备提供稳定而持续的能源供应。未来通过更高效率的能量转换技术、更智能的能量管理系统,能量收集将在降低电池依赖、延长设备寿命、提升能源自给率方面发挥更大作用。

半导体材料在电源领域的应用与发展趋势 半导体材料在电源领域的应用与发展趋势 发布日期:2025-09-29

随着全球对高效能电源转换技术的需求不断提升,半导体材料在电源领域的应用日益重要。从传统的硅(Si)功率元器件,到近年来快速崛起的宽带隙半导体材料——碳化硅(SiC)与氮化镓(GaN),这些技术的进步正在驱动电源转换技术向更高效、更高功率密度、更低损耗的方向发展,使得电源系统能够在更小的体积内达成更高的功效与可靠性。
